Who says you can't love beauty and animals at the same time? Years ago, it would have been difficult to find decent makeup and skincare brands that do not test on animals, but today many brands are stepping up to the plate and pledging to be cruelty-free. For those of you who don't know, the claim "cruelty-free" means that animals such as rabbits, rats, mice, and guinea pigs are not used for the safety testing of a cosmetic ingredient or product.

According to The Human Society, these tests include:

  • Skin and eye irritation tests where chemicals are rubbed onto the shaved skin or dripped into the eyes of restrained rabbits without any pain relief
  • Repeated force-feeding studies lasting weeks or months to look for signs of general illness or specific health hazards such as cancer or birth defects
  • Widely condemned "lethal dose" tests, in which animals are forced to swallow large amounts of a test chemical to determine the dose that causes death

At the end of a test, the animals are normally killed by asphyxiation, neck-breaking or decapitation with no pain relief. In the U.S., a large percentage of the animals used in such testing (such as laboratory-bred rats and mice) are not counted in official statistics and receive no protection under the Animal Welfare Act. Brands that sell their products in China, however, are not cruelty-free because animal testing is required in China for all foreign cosmetics. On the other hand, animal testing is not required in the U.S. and is avoidable.

Here's my top ten cruelty-free makeup and skincare brands, and some of their best products:

1. NYX Cosmetics

I'm a fan of any affordable and highly pigmented makeup that I can find at Target. NYX has a great shade range for lipstick, eyeshadow, and foundation for all skin tones.

My favorites are their Ultimate Multi-Finish Shadow Palette and Liquid Suede Cream Lipstick.

2. The Body Shop

With tons of natural bath and body products including cleansers, lotions, toners, fragrances, and more, The Body Shop has something for everyone.

I love their amazing tea tree oil collection, especially the Tea Tree Mattifying Lotion and Tea Tree Skin Clearing Facial Wash.

3. Glossier

I have an intense love for this brand, which advertises skincare and makeup that requires minimal effort to apply, but leaves you looking dewy and fresh every morning.

My favorites are the Stretch Concealer and Coconut Balm Dot Com.

4. Colourpop

Like NYX, Colourpop is another wallet-friendly but high-quality makeup brand, specializing in lipstick, eyeshadow, and highlighter.

I recommend their creamy Lippie Stix and luminous Super Shock Highlighter.

5. Nip + Fab

This brand carries a line of innovative skincare products to target specific concerns, including acne, dry skin, and aging.

I love their moisturizing Dragon's Blood Fix Plumping Serum and Yoga Blend Body Lotion for my super dry skin.

6. Bare Minerals

This brand slays the no-makeup look and boasts face makeup that is hypoallergenic, non-comedogenic, and actually improves your skin over time.

Check out their amazing Original Loose Powder Foundation SPF 15.

7. e.l.f.

e.l.f., which I just discovered stands for eyes lips face, is a super cheap makeup brand that actually has some pretty great products.

I love and use their Mineral Infused Face Primer and Instant Lift Brow Pencil (which only costs $2!) every day.

8. Supergoop

I probably wouldn't have tried this brand of sun care products if Birchbox hadn't sent it to me, but I definitely fell in love.

They offer a range of face, body, and lip products with different levels of SPF including their Defense Refresh Setting Mist SPF 50 which smells like rosemary and makes my makeup last all day.

9. Kat Von D

Kat Von D's edgy and bold makeup collection has a little of everything, including eyeshadow, liquid lipstick, eyeliner, foundation and more. Plus, the company is working towards going completely vegan in addition to being cruelty-free.

For cat-eye queens like me, their Tattoo Liner is life-changing

10. Too Faced

This super sweet cult-favorite brand offers tons of makeup in adorable packaging. They're especially well-known for their sweet peach and chocolate bar eyeshadow palettes.

Personally, I love their Milk Chocolate Soleil Bronzer and Better Than Sex Mascara.


Many beauty companies try to hide their animal testing policies, so it's important to always check the packaging and do your research. There are tons of cruelty-free companies to choose from in addition to these, which you can check out here.
